On 8/16/22 09:25, Eli Zaretskii wrote:
> The programmer didn't
> expect that because it is natural to expect each call to a function
> that creates a temporary file to create a file under a new name, not
> reuse the same name.
Regardless of whether the programmer expects a random name or a
predictable-but-unique name, there are only a finite number of names to
choose from so the programmer must take into account the possibility
that the chosen name clashes with names that the programmer would prefer
not to be chosen.
This means an Emacs patch such as [1] is needed regardless of whether
Gnulib's gen_tempname is changed to be more random than it is. Although
it's true that the bug fixed by [1] is less likely if gen_tempname
generates more-random names, the bug can occur no matter what we do
about gen_tempname.
